Test Plan Note — Calendar Sync Conflict (Tindervale Scheduler)

Scenario: two clients edit the same event offline, then sync. Expected behavior: the Larkmoor merge service keeps the later timestamp and files a conflict record. Verify the losing edit appears in the conflicts pane and no duplicate events are created. Run against the staging tenant only. Authenticate your test client to the sync endpoint using the bearer token below.

bearer token for hagug-kawip: eyJhbGciOiJIUzI1NiIsInR5cCI6IkpXVCJ9.eyJzdWIiOiIydxNAjDeTmIn0.L86yxoGFcrhy

**Ticket: Config drift in Formula Sandbox workers (Quillbase)**

Three of the eight sandbox workers evaluating user-supplied formulas are running last quarter's policy bundle, which permits network syscalls the current policy denies. Drift likely came from a manual hotfix that bypassed the provisioning pipeline. No exploitation observed in logs. For reference during review, the intended worker configuration is as follows.

config for baweg-fahop:
[praael]
host = praael.qorvellabs.corp
user = praael_svc
database = praael_prod

Subject: Pilot churn — where we stand

Hi team,

Quick update for our incoming director on the Larchgate pilot. We've lost 9 of 60 pilot customers this quarter — mostly smaller accounts citing onboarding friction, not pricing. Renna's group is reworking the setup flow, and early feedback from the Copperfen cohort is encouraging. I'd call this fixable, not fatal. Full breakdown attached. The context that frames our response sits just below.

confidential, hahap-bahaf: Fenathix Freight plans to lower the Sildor list price by 53.5 percent in November. The board signed off on a budget of $241.8 million for Project Druwyn. The renewal with Holvanax Foods closes at $381.7 million a year, 25.5 percent below the last contract. Project Silmir slips by one quarter because of the supplier delay.

TURN-208: Gatevale turnstile counters at the Merrow Field pilot double-count when a rotation reverses mid-cycle. Attendance totals drift roughly 2% high per event. The debounce window fix is implemented, reviewed by Ilsa, and soak-tested across two simulated match days without drift. Ready for your cut; the candidate build is identified below.

trace token, tagag-tafog: htk6_5ed18c